Output de9011ec27aa37f7cc6b5bf2ebf585698edebe19137740d64b00dbdfd84c50ab:8

value
29039065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5a006569a43711031d62e984a76d8b621ed906e OP_EQUAL
address
3Gnm7ungm68mwkRZGfgHKJBpFcRFyQpuMk
transaction
de9011ec27aa37f7cc6b5bf2ebf585698edebe19137740d64b00dbdfd84c50ab
confirmations
266097
spent
true